We can use the following equation for the potential difference between two parallel plates given an electric field and separation distance:
[tex]V = Ed[/tex]

V = Potential Difference (? V)
E = Electric field strength (100.0 N/C)

d = distance between places (0.02 m)

Plug in the values and solve.

[tex]V = (100)(0.02) = \boxed{2 V}[/tex]
